Antananarivo is famous for its colorful celebrations that every tourist will find incredibly interesting to visit. Traditional Christian celebrations, such as Christmas and Easter, remain the most popular holidays in the city. On these days, there are always many people outside. Friends and family members visit each other and exchange symbolic gifts. On the Christmas Eve, specially decorated stalls appear on the streets. They offer interesting souvenirs and pastries. Catholic Christmas attracts a large number of tourists to Madagascar, as it is celebrated on a grand scale here. All the buildings are decorated with Christmas attributes and garlands. Madagascar Santa Clauses, differing from American - leanness, stroll through the streets and treat children with snacks. Local residents perform hymns and organize performances and concerts. This day is the most important holiday on the island and is saturated with the festive spirit of Christmas fun. On September 27, residents of Antananarivo and its environs celebrate St. Vincent de Paul's Day - a holiday of universal repentance and compassion for our fellow people.
